Language
Russian women speak Russian as their primary language. Ukrainian women may speak Ukrainian, Russian, or both -- often switching between them fluidly. In western Ukraine, Ukrainian is dominant; in eastern and southern regions, Russian was historically more common. Many Ukrainian women in the diaspora are also learning English, Polish, German, or other European languages.

Marriage Traditions: Russian vs Ukrainian Weddings
If you are marrying a Slavic woman, you will likely encounter rich wedding traditions that have been celebrated for centuries. Understanding these traditions shows respect and deepens your connection to her culture. For a detailed cost analysis, see our article on Russian wedding costs in 2026.
Russian Wedding Traditions
- Vykup nevesty (Bride ransoming) -- the groom must complete challenges and pay a symbolic "ransom" to the bride's family before she will appear. This is a fun, theatrical event filled with jokes and games.
- ZAGS ceremony -- the civil ceremony at the registry office is the legal requirement. Many couples also have a church ceremony afterward.
- Gorko! -- wedding guests shout "Gorko!" (Bitter!) to demand that the newlyweds kiss, supposedly to sweeten the bitter drink. The longer the kiss, the louder the cheers.
- Two-day celebrations -- traditional Russian weddings often span two days, with the second day featuring more casual festivities, games, and outdoor activities.
- Bread and salt -- the parents greet the newlyweds with a loaf of bread topped with salt. Each spouse takes a bite; whoever takes the bigger piece is said to be the head of the family.
Ukrainian Wedding Traditions
- Vinok (floral crown) -- Ukrainian brides traditionally wear a flower crown or wreath, symbolizing purity and joy. Modern brides often incorporate this into their look alongside a conventional veil.
- Rushnyk (embroidered towel) -- the couple stands on an embroidered towel during the ceremony. This towel, often hand-embroidered by the bride's family, symbolizes their shared path in life.
- Korovai (wedding bread) -- an elaborately decorated bread that is central to the celebration. It is baked by married women from the community and symbolizes prosperity and community blessing.
- Tree planting -- some Ukrainian weddings include the couple planting a tree together, symbolizing the growth of their family and their roots in the community.
- Hopak dancing -- energetic traditional dancing is a highlight of Ukrainian wedding receptions, often with professional dancers and audience participation.
Both Russian and Ukrainian weddings share a common theme: they are celebrations of community, family, and the beginning of a new chapter. As a foreign groom, participating enthusiastically in these traditions -- even imperfectly -- will win the hearts of your bride's family and friends.
